How Our Laundry Room Water Removal Process Works

Laundry room water removal is a complex process that needs precision and care. Our team follows a strict protocol to ensure your home is safe, dry, and restored to its original condition. Here’s a step-by-step breakdown of what you can expect:

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Our technicians will arrive at your home and assess the damage. We’ll contain the affected area to prevent further water damage and create a safe working environment.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to extract as much water as possible from your laundry room. This step is crucial in preventing mold and mildew grow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your laundry room, including air movers and dehumidifiers. This step is essential in preventing further damage and ensuring your space is safe to occupy.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once your laundry room is dry, we’ll clean and sanitize the area to prevent the growth of bacteria and mold.

Step 5: Restoration and Repair

Our team will work with you to repair or replace any damaged items, including flooring, walls, and cabinets.

Warning Signs You Need Laundry Room Water Removal

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Don’t wait until it’s too late, catch these signs early and prevent further damage: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your laundry room, it’s a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it, call us today to schedule an assessment.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Water damage can cause your flooring to warp or buckle. If you notice this happening, it’s essential to address the issue immediately to prevent further damage.

Stains or Discoloration on Walls or Ceilings

Water damage can cause unsightly stains or discoloration on your walls or ceilings. Don’t try to cover it up, call us to schedule an assessment and get the issue resolved.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Water damage can cause peeling paint or wallpaper. If you notice this happening, it’s a sign that water has seeped into your walls and needs to be addressed.

Unusual Sounds or Squeaks

Water damage can cause unusual sounds or squeaks in your walls or floors. Don’t ignore it, call us today to schedule an assessment and get the issue resolved.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old and mildew growth are serious health hazards. If you notice this happening in your laundry room, don’t wait, call us today to schedule an assessment and get the issue resolved.

Laundry Room Water Removal Cost in Burleson, TX

The cost of laundry room water removal in Burleson,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here’s a rough estimate of what you can expect: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Cleaning and s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of materials affected
Restoration and repair $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, type of materials affected
Dehumidification and drying equipment rental $100 – $500 Size of affected area, duration of rental
Insurance claims processing $0 – $500 Complexity of claims process, number of parties involved
